    Out of curiosity, who did you expect would reply?  WGT mods seldom reply to those types of questions.   I don't know if the problem might be browser related, especially if you are using Firefox.  A recent update on that browser has caused lots of problems.

    Or it could be a corrupted flash file problem.  You can try clearing your browser history and your flash cache.  If the problem persists, try a different browser.  You also can contact Customer Service using the 'Contact" link below first.  That is the best way to contact WGT for help directly from them.
